The Evolution of Le Pen's Strategy: From Confrontation to Pragmatism?

While initially characterized by a confrontational, overtly nationalist approach, Le Pen's political strategy has demonstrably evolved. Her "nouvelle progression" isn't solely about maintaining a hardline stance; it's about strategic adaptation and broadening her appeal. This shift is evident in several key areas:

Softening the Image: A Calculated Move?

Early perceptions of Le Pen and the National Rally (formerly the National Front) were deeply rooted in accusations of xenophobia and extremism. However, recent efforts have focused on presenting a more moderate, less overtly confrontational image. This involves a calculated effort to appeal to a wider range of voters, moving beyond the traditional core base of disaffected and marginalized citizens. This calculated image-softening strategy includes a focus on economic issues and a more measured tone in public pronouncements.

Economic Populism: A Resonant Theme

Le Pen's "nouvelle progression" is significantly linked to her economic platform, which resonates deeply with segments of the French population struggling with economic insecurity. Her populist rhetoric focuses on protectionism, emphasizing the need to safeguard French jobs and industries from global competition. This message connects strongly with communities affected by deindustrialization and globalization's negative consequences. Her proposals for reducing taxes and strengthening social safety nets target the growing anxieties around economic inequality, creating a powerful appeal to many disillusioned voters.

Addressing Social Concerns: Beyond Immigration

While immigration remains a central theme in Le Pen's political discourse, her strategy now involves a more nuanced approach. While not abandoning her core nationalist base, she increasingly frames immigration issues within broader social and economic contexts. The emphasis has shifted from merely opposing immigration to addressing the associated challenges, such as integration, social services, and the overall impact on communities. This approach seeks to broaden her appeal by acknowledging legitimate concerns without relying solely on divisive rhetoric.

The Socio-Political Context: Why Le Pen's Support is Growing

Le Pen's "nouvelle progression" isn't solely a product of her evolving strategy. It is intricately linked to the broader socio-political climate in France. Several factors contribute to the fertile ground for her rise:

Economic Inequality and Precarious Employment

France, like many Western nations, faces significant challenges related to economic inequality and job insecurity. The rise of precarious employment and the widening gap between the rich and the poor create fertile ground for populist messages that promise economic relief and social justice. Le Pen's economic proposals tap into these anxieties, promising solutions that resonate with those feeling left behind by mainstream politics.

Erosion of Trust in Traditional Institutions

A growing sense of disillusionment with mainstream political parties and institutions has fueled support for outsider candidates like Le Pen. Years of economic stagnation, political scandals, and perceived failures to address pressing social issues have eroded public trust. This decline in confidence provides an opening for populist figures who offer an alternative narrative and promise radical change.

Cultural Identity and National Identity Politics

The debate surrounding national identity and cultural values remains a significant factor in Le Pen's success. Her focus on French cultural heritage and her criticisms of multiculturalism resonate with those who feel a sense of loss or displacement in a rapidly changing society. The rise of nationalist sentiment across Europe has created a sympathetic environment for her message, offering a sense of belonging and security in an increasingly globalized world.

The Weakness of the Established Parties

The decline in support for traditional parties โ€“ both on the left and the right โ€“ has left a vacuum in the French political landscape. This weakness has created an opportunity for Le Pen and the National Rally to position themselves as a viable alternative, attracting voters disillusioned with the established political order. This vacuum represents a critical element contributing to Le Penโ€™s "nouvelle progression".

The Implications for France's Future: A Potential Turning Point?

The continued rise of Le Pen and the National Rally has profound implications for France's political and social landscape. Her potential success could lead to significant policy shifts impacting various aspects of French society:

Immigration and Integration Policies: A Potential Shift

Le Penโ€™s success would undoubtedly result in significant changes to immigration policies, potentially leading to stricter controls and a more restrictive approach to integration. This could have far-reaching consequences for France's multicultural society and its international relations.

Economic Policy: A Protectionist Turn?

A Le Pen presidency would likely lead to a more protectionist economic policy, potentially impacting France's relationships within the European Union and the global trading system. This shift could have both positive and negative consequences for the French economy.

Foreign Policy: A Realignment of Alliances?

Le Pen's views on foreign policy differ significantly from those of mainstream parties. Her potential rise to power could lead to a reassessment of France's alliances and its role in international organizations.
